[Remote] Senior Drug Safety Associate, Pharmcoviligence - US - Remote

Remote role Full-time Open position

Note The job is a remote job and is open to candidates in USA. Worldwide Clinical Trials is a global, midsize CRO committed to improving lives through innovative approaches. The Senior Drug Safety Associate will be responsible for the collection, processing, evaluation, and reporting of Serious Adverse Event data, serving as a lead on complex studies while mentoring junior staff.

Responsibilities

  • Author Safety Management Plan for assigned studies
  • Review incoming SAE data for completeness and accuracy
  • Perform data entry in the Safety Database and/or complete applicable tracking of incoming safety information
  • Generate queries for missing or unclear information and follow-up with sites for resolution
  • Perform QC of SAEs processed by other PV Associates
  • Generate regulatory reports and perform safety submissions as needed Skills
